Kazakhstan gradually reopening international flights to a number of states from 17 August

Astana. August 13. KazTAG - Kazakhstan is gradually reopening international flights to a number of states from August 17, reports the press service of the Civil Aviation Committee.
“ Taking into account the recommendations of the Ministry of Health Care of the Republic of Kazakhstan and the level of the epidemiological situation, the  international flights to the United Arab Emirates, the Republic of Belarus, Germany, the Netherlands, Egypt, Ukraine and the Russian Federation will be gradually resumed from August 17, ” reads the statement.
